15 killed, millions displaced as landslides hit Bangladesh and India : Analysis
Heavy monsoon rains have triggered landslides in Bangladesh and India, resulting in at least 15 deaths, many injuries, and displacing millions, officials reported. Among those killed were eight Rohingya Muslims due to mudslides in Bangladesh, where more than one million Rohingya refugees reside in overcrowded camps. Landslides also occurred in northeastern Bangladesh, leaving hundreds of thousands stranded by floods. In neighboring India’s Assam state, six people died in floods and landslides, with more than 160,000 affected by the extreme weather conditions. Additionally, New Delhi is experiencing a severe heatwave, with hospitals reporting heatstroke-related deaths amid record-breaking temperatures.
